Section 4561.60

 
Section 4561.60 is not yet in effect. It takes effect October 6, 2026.

As used in sections 4561.60 to 4561.64 of the Revised Code:

(A) "Surveillance data" means the data collected by an unmanned aerial vehicle during its flight, including images, videos, or other forms of observation recording.

(B) "Flight data" means the data pertaining to an unmanned aerial vehicle's flight from both the original plan for the flight and the actual flight that was taken, including the flight's duration, path, and mission objectives.

(C) "Law enforcement agency" means a government entity that employs peace officers to perform law enforcement duties.

(D) "Peace officer" has the same meaning as in section 2935.01 of the Revised Code.

(E) "Unmanned aerial vehicle" and "unmanned aerial vehicle system" have the same meanings as in section 4561.50 of the Revised Code.
